The chapel on the hill

Chapelle de la colline
Chapelle de la colline
Chapelle de la colline

Description

This chapel is dedicated to the Holy Virgin and was built by the villagers to thank her for protecting them during the two World Wars. On the right of the chapel, you can see a rather impressive and distinctive statue of the Holy Virgin, the queen of the universe, crushing a snake’s head. The snake symbolises evil. The statue is the work of a renowned sculptor: Louis Thomas de Sohier.
